Scope
GB/T 44730-2024 is the English-translated version of 经济贸易展览会 境内举办指南.
GB/T 44730-2024 is the Chinese national standard covering an economic and trade exhibition held inside China, from the decision to run it to the closing day — the general principles of systematicity and foresight, the basic framework, the organisation and management through project establishment, preparation, marketing, implementation and the finale, the evaluation and improvement afterwards, and the budget example and implementation plan framework in the annexes that an organiser can work from. First edition, in force from 26 October 2024. Issued on 26 October 2024, it has been in force since 26 October 2024.

Guidelines for Holding Economic and Trade Exhibitions in China
1 Scope
This document sets out the general principles for holding economic and trade exhibitions in China, and provides the basic framework, organization and management, evaluation and improvement methods. Surface guidance.
This document applies to the organization and management of domestic economic and trade exhibitions by exhibition organizers.

4 General Principles
4.1 Systematicity
It is advisable to establish a sound organizational management and quality management system, cultivate a professional team, focus on the needs of exhibitors and visitors, and Plan exhibition positioning and brand strategy.
4.2 Foresight
It is advisable to follow the green environmental protection and information development concept, conform to the innovative development trend of each service link of the exhibition, and use advanced technology to achieve The current exhibition project is sustainable.
